Transaction 25e7723b9d43303e4bb30865cde90127740bfb0fadfffdef0ef16178c5eb6f63

block
3176a6035163c499464cfca385d51938f495d1c3d151b85a6eccb529f6c6f8cf

1 Input

201 Outputs